Effective Ways to Check Uber Prices
Utilizing the Uber Fare Estimator
The Uber Fare Estimator is a fantastic tool for passengers looking to gauge their ride costs beforehand. By entering your pickup and drop-off locations, you can receive an estimated fare based on distance, time, and current demand.
This tool incorporates features like surge pricing awareness, helping you understand how peak times may affect your overall fare. Furthermore, the estimator can provide a range of fare estimates, making it easier to determine the best time to book your ride based on expected pricing fluctuations.
Additionally, familiarity with the fare structure, which includes base rates and variable costs dependent on distance and duration, is essential for effectively using this tool. Overall, utilizing the Uber Fare Estimator amplifies fare transparency and enables you to monitor pricing efficiently.

Factors Affecting Uber Prices and How to Estimate Them
Having covered the tools available for checking Uber prices, it's essential to understand the various factors affecting these prices. This understanding will enable you to estimate rides accurately and avoid unexpected costs.
Understanding Surge Pricing
One of the critical aspects influencing ride costs is surge pricing. Uber employs a dynamic pricing model, which raises fares during times of high demand. Users should familiarize themselves with times when surge pricing is most likely to occur, such as during rush hours or local events.
Understanding these price spikes allows you to make smarter decisions about when to book rides. Whenever possible, checking fare predictions and being aware of surge pricing can prevent overpaying for rides, ensuring a more budget-friendly travel experience.
Distance and Time-Based Fare Calculations
Uber fares are primarily calculated based on distance and time. Riders can utilize this information to estimate fares by analyzing their typical travel routes. By knowing the average distance to frequently visited locations and the time it takes to cover those distances, users can approximate their fares.
Moreover, incorporating features from the Uber pricing calculator can enhance your ability to estimate rides effectively. This tool breaks down both time and distance components, presenting clear insights into the costs associated with each journey.

Frequently Asked Questions: Uber Pricing
How does the Uber fare estimator work?
The Uber fare estimator uses your pickup location, destination, and selected ride option to calculate anticipated ride costs. It analyzes dynamic variables like time and distance to provide a price range.
How can I avoid surge pricing?
To avoid surge pricing, check the fare estimator during times of expected demand. If it indicates potential surges, consider waiting for a more favorable time to book your ride.
